
Overview
Pellevé is designed to tighten neck skin by heating the tissue with a radio wave frequency. The Pellevé neck skin tightening treatment tip provides a continuous deep warming with optimal temperature which targets the subdermal junction and allows delivery of heat to the dermis, subcutaneous tissue and deeper structures such as the fibrous septae fascia. It offers a safe, customizable, easy to perform, reproducible and well tolerated non-surgical neck skin tightening treatment.
Collagen:
- Collagen is comprised of proteins which make up a supporting structure surrounding the skin cells.
- Collagen formation and breakdown takes place in the dermis or inner skin, the thicker, firm layer of skin that lies beneath the paper-thin outer skin or epidermis, much as a mattress lies beneath a sheet.
- In youthful skin collagen is firm, taut and abundant, like a new mattress. In older skin, the collagen structure begins to fall away.
- Just as a foam mattress over time becomes flatter and creased in places as its structure breaks down, aging skin begins to sag and wrinkle when its collagen is diminished and fragmented.
- A wrinkle is caused by the break down and reduction of collagen.
Why we get Wrinkles and Skin Laxity:
- Skin ages as a consequence of the passage of time.
- Sun damage degrades the skin’s normal collagen fibers and causes the accumulation of abnormal elastic fibers.
- UV radiation causes collagen to break down at higher rates than chronological aging.
- When the skin is repeatedly exposed to UV radiation, the permanent formation of disorganized collagen fibers forms solar scars, or “Wrinkles”.

Fibrous Septae and its role for Immediate Skin Tightening:
- Ten to thirty percent of subcutaneous tissue is composed of collagen-based fibrous septae which form a connective tissue network interlaced between fat locules (see illustration below). These fibrous septae threads give skin its structure and shape.
- Researchers have found that monopolar radio frequency (MRF) stimulates the collagen-based fibrous septae.
- MRF energy, following the path of least resistance, is conducted to the natural fibrous septae threads.
- MRF is not conducted to the fat layer since fat is >12 times resistant to the energy, therefore causing the heat to build in the fibrous septae.
- The selective heating of the fibrous septae, tightens and remodels the collagen, producing the immediate tightening that is seen with Pellevé treatments.

Role of Fibroblasts in the Extended Repair Process:
- Fibroblasts are the basic building blocks of collagen.
- After thermal injury has occurred, causing micro-scarring in the dermis, fibroblasts possess a unique ability to change to myofibroblasts, (a fibroblast having some of the characteristics of smooth muscle cells, such as contractile properties) which contribute actively to the repair process.
- Skin tightening occurs as the skin’s repair cells, the fibroblasts, pull collagen strands together.
- Researchers have observed for years that fibroblasts in aged tissue do not produce as much collagen.
- Once fibroblasts have been exposed to thermal injury they once again produce significant amounts of collagen.
Skin Rejuvenation:
- By producing a thermal injury, new collagen growth is stimulated to effectively restructure and restore the dermis to a state that resembles undamaged skin.
- The same immediate collagen contraction and dermal remodeling that is observed in the dermis also takes place in the deeper structural collagen as well.
- Skin tightening cannot occur without high levels of vitamin C (ascorbic acid) in your skin. Vitamin C levels in the skin are easily increased by taking at least one gram daily as a supplement.
- Concomitant use of salicylic acid or glycolic acid products that remove the older cells on the skin’s surface also helps with skin tightening. Hydroxy acids produce a very mild skin damage as they remove older skin cells but this helps the renewal process, probably by increasing the numbers of the skin repair cell, the fibroblast.
- This manifests as a more youthful appearance and improved skin texture with firming, lifting, tightening and smoothing of the skin.
